S1P mediates temporal secretion of myokines in hypoxic differentiating C2C12 cells. Media supernatant from S1P (1 μM) and VC pretreated differentiating C2C12 cells under normoxia (N) and 0.5% hypoxia (H) at various time points was analyzed for the composition of secreted myokines—IL-6 (a), IFN-γ (b) and TNF-α (c); 0.2 × 105/cm2 C2C12 cells were seeded and induced to differentiate as described. Following this the media supernatant was snap-frozen for myokine content analysis using a sandwich ELISA-based commercial kit. Data are reported as mean ± SD from three independent experiments carried out in triplicate. Statistical analysis was performed using the one-way ANOVA/post hoc Bonferroni’s analysis method. Statistical significance is denoted by NVC vs. HVC ($p < 0.05, *p ≤ 0.005) and HVC vs. HS1P (@p < 0.05, #p ≤ 0.005) at respective time points
